Development of Affordable Cluster Houses of Amphibian Nature

India with a coastline of total 7517 km and numerous rivers is exposed to the hazard of flood that claims hundreds of lives every year. The reason lies with the rising sea level due to global warming and falling capacity of river basin due to increasing number of dams to cater agricultural and hydraulic power requirement. Hence it is of paramount interest to develop technology for flood-resistant structures to house people especially the poor one living in vulnerable shelter bordering the waterline. ACCCRN (Asian Cities Climate Change Resilience Network) program has initiated cluster housing for flood prone areas of Surat in western India. However, the easiest solution of stilted house was discarded in this case with intermittent water logging because such house detaches the habitants from their normal community level network for a considerable amount of time when there is no flooding. This research proposes amphibian housing model suitable for dry and water-logged environment. Unlike the Dutch or American examples, the scheme is made cost effective by using two pronged approach, namely, space planning and material selection. Thoughtful planning reduced length of wall, grouped services and employed precast modular units. Lightweight material such as extended polystyrene foam (EPS) or shingles made the structure lightweight. Also common foundation for the housing cluster reduced the amount of buoyant material compared to individual foundation. Two types of houses are developed with plinth areas 44.6 sq.m. and 22 sq.m. The proposed amphibian concept is expected to be extended to bigger houses and at community level where the roads can also float along with the basic services.
